Nutritional Needs of Soldiers in Combat and Training
The nutritional needs of soldiers in combat and training are highly specific and demanding due to the physical and mental stress they encounter. These requirements include increased energy intake to sustain prolonged physical activity and combat readiness. Carbohydrates are essential as the primary energy source, providing quick and sustained fuel during rigorous tasks.
Protein intake is vital for muscle repair, recovery, and maintaining immunity, especially after intense physical exertion. Additionally, adequate fat consumption supplies essential fatty acids and concentrated energy for extended operations. Vitamins and minerals are equally important to support vital physiological functions, enhance resilience, and prevent deficiencies under stressful conditions.
Hydration plays a critical role in maintaining performance, thermoregulation, and cognitive function. Soldiers often operate in environments with extreme temperatures, necessitating proper fluid balance to prevent dehydration. Understanding these nutritional needs ensures that military personnel are equipped for optimal performance, resilience, and recovery during combat and training activities.
Challenges in Providing Adequate Dietary Support in Military Settings
Providing adequate dietary support for soldiers in military settings presents multiple challenges. One primary issue is logistical constraints, which can hinder the timely delivery of nutritious food, especially in remote or combat zones. Such environments often limit storage options and transportation capacity, complicating consistent access to high-quality provisions.
Another significant challenge involves balancing nutritional requirements with operational demands. Soldiers engaged in strenuous activities require tailored diets that meet their energy and recovery needs, yet military rations must also be compact, durable, and easy to prepare, which can restrict nutrient diversity and freshness.
Furthermore, maintaining dietary discipline in field conditions proves difficult due to limited availability of preferred or culturally appropriate foods. Soldier compliance with nutritional protocols can be compromised by taste fatigue, dietary restrictions, or operational stress, affecting overall nutritional intake.
Finally, ensuring quality control and food safety in diverse environments is complex. Military settings must prevent contamination and spoilage, which demands rigorous monitoring and advanced technologies. Overcoming these challenges is essential to provide effective nutrition and dietary support for soldiers across varied operational contexts.

Development of military-specific ration packs
The development of military-specific ration packs involves designing nutritionally balanced, durable, and portable food solutions tailored to soldiers’ operational needs. These ration packs are essential for maintaining optimal performance during deployments or training exercises.
Such packs are carefully formulated to include a variety of food groups, ensuring adequate intake of calories, proteins, vitamins, and minerals. They are engineered to withstand harsh environmental conditions, such as extreme heat, cold, or moisture, without compromising nutritional integrity.
Innovations in packaging technology have enabled longer shelf lives and ease of use, facilitating rapid consumption in tactical situations. Developments also focus on minimizing weight, maximizing caloric density, and reducing waste, thus supporting soldiers’ mobility and energy requirements.
Furthermore, military-specific ration packs are regularly updated to incorporate emerging nutritional research and functional foods. This ensures that they meet the evolving dietary support needs of soldiers, aligning with best practices in nutrition and operational readiness.
Incorporation of functional foods and supplements
The incorporation of functional foods and supplements into military nutrition strategies aims to optimize soldier performance and resilience. These specialized foods contain bioactive compounds designed to support energy, cognitive function, and immune response. Their targeted inclusion in dietary protocols allows for tailored support during demanding operational conditions.
Such foods may include fortified energy bars, beverages enriched with vitamins and minerals, or probiotics to enhance gastrointestinal health. Supplements like omega-3 fatty acids, amino acids, and herbal extracts are also integrated to address specific nutritional gaps or physiological needs. Their strategic use can reduce fatigue, improve mental alertness, and promote quicker recovery from intense physical activity.
While evidence supports the potential benefits, rigorous research and standardized guidelines are necessary to ensure safety and efficacy. Proper integration of functional foods and supplements requires collaboration among nutrition experts, military medical personnel, and operational strategists to align with mission demands and individual soldier health profiles.

Role of Hydration in Military Performance
Hydration is a fundamental component of maintaining optimal military performance, especially during combat and rigorous training. Adequate fluid intake helps regulate body temperature, prevent heat-related illnesses, and sustain physical endurance. Dehydration can impair cognitive functions, reduce strength, and increase fatigue, all of which compromise operational effectiveness.
For soldiers in demanding environments, strategic hydration protocols are vital. These protocols often include scheduled water consumption and the use of electrolyte-replenishing beverages to replace lost minerals. Proper hydration not only supports physical health but also enhances mental alertness and decision-making under stress.
Military nutrition programs increasingly emphasize hydration as part of a comprehensive dietary approach. Innovations in portable water purification and monitoring technologies assist in ensuring soldiers have access to clean, sufficient fluids. Overall, prioritizing hydration remains crucial to maintaining soldier resilience, endurance, and mission readiness.

Advances in Dietary Technologies and Innovations
Advances in dietary technologies and innovations have significantly improved the effectiveness of nutrition and dietary support for soldiers. These innovations enable precise customization, optimize nutrient delivery, and enhance convenience for military personnel in diverse operational environments.
Recent developments include portable nutrient analyzers, which quickly assess soldiers’ nutritional status in the field, allowing real-time dietary adjustments. The utilization of smart packaging technology also ensures food safety and prolongs shelf life for military rations.
Emerging food processing techniques, such as preservative-free dehydration and 3D food printing, facilitate the creation of tailored meals that meet specific nutritional requirements efficiently. These innovations support the development of military-specific ration packs that are lightweight, nutrient-dense, and easy to prepare.
Key technological advancements include:
- Portable diagnostics for rapid nutritional assessment
- Smart packaging for enhanced food safety
- 3D printing for customized meal production
- Advanced dehydration and preservation methods
These developments contribute substantially to maintaining optimal nutrition and dietary support for soldiers, especially during demanding operational scenarios.

Monitoring and Evaluating Nutritional Status in Military Personnel
Monitoring and evaluating the nutritional status of military personnel is essential for ensuring optimal performance and health. Accurate assessment helps identify nutritional deficiencies and guides targeted interventions.
Common methods include biochemical tests, anthropometric measurements, and dietary intake analyses. These assessments provide a comprehensive view of soldiers’ nutritional health, enabling informed decision-making.
Key techniques involve blood tests to measure micronutrient levels, body composition analyses such as BMI and skinfold measurements, and dietary recall surveys. Regular monitoring facilitates early detection of nutritional issues and promotes timely corrective actions.
Practical implementation often involves structured protocols, including scheduled health screenings and performance assessments. These tools help maintain high standards of nutritional support tailored to military operational demands.

Future Directions in Nutrition and Dietary Support for Soldiers
Emerging research points toward personalized nutrition as a promising future direction for supporting soldiers effectively. Tailoring dietary plans based on individual genetics, activity levels, and operational demands can optimize performance and recovery. Advances in nutrigenomics will likely play a significant role in this personalization.
Innovations in dietary technology are also expected to revolutionize military nutrition support. Smart packaging, portable analytical devices, and digital tracking systems can ensure real-time monitoring of nutritional intake and hydration, allowing for immediate adjustments and improved dietary compliance.
Furthermore, integrating functional foods and specialized supplements designed for resilience and cognitive enhancement remains a key focus. These developments aim to bolster physical endurance, mental clarity, and overall resilience in extreme operational environments. Continued research will help validate and refine these approaches to maximize their effectiveness.
Finally, sustainable and environmentally friendly food solutions are emerging as vital considerations for future dietary protocols, aligning military nutrition with global sustainability goals. Overall, these future strategies will be driven by technological innovation, personalization, and environmental consciousness to support the evolving needs of soldiers.
